Mary J. Blige Sparkles in Asymmetric Dress by Yousef Al Jasmi With Dramatic Train for Angel Ball’s 25th Anniversary Performance

Mary J. Blige brought her signature sparkling glamour to the 25th Anniversary Angel Ball on Monday in New York City, wearing an asymmetric gown from Yousef Al Jasmi.

Blige performed at the event, which helps fund cancer research.

The dress featured a dramatic high-low hem design with a train attached to one of the sleeves, with embellishments throughout. Blige paired the gown with Giuseppe Zanotti sandals.

Yousef Al Jasmi is known for his tailored and glittery ensembles — Taylor Swift, Ice Spice, Cardi B and Beyoncé are among the celebrities who have worn his designs.

When it comes to her style, Blige often looks to either stylist Maurícía Henry or Jeremy Haynes.

Blige is no stranger to head-turning looks. To the Clooney Foundation for Justice’s “The Albies” in September, she wore a Tony Ward Couture silver blazer dress with dramatic, elongated fringe detailing.

To present Diddy with the Global Icon Award at the 2023 MTV Vmas that same month, she went all-black in an Albina Dyla sparkling set with a feather-adorned high-low skirt.

The 25th Anniversary Angel Ball was an annual fundraiser event hosted by Gabrielle’s Angel Foundation for cancer research. It included appearances by Ubah Hassan, Tina Knowles, Robin Thicke, Tamron Hall and more. According to the foundation on average, 88 cents of every dollar raised at the annual ball supports the country’s top cancer research scientists and specialists.
